Euro area construction output down 0.2 percent in August from July

According to first estimates released by Eurostat, the Statistical Office of the European Communities, in August this year the seasonally-adjusted production of the construction sector in the European Union member states (EU-28) decreased by 0.4 percent compared to July and rose by 3.1 percent compared to the same month of 2016. In July, production rose 0.1 percent compared to the previous month.

In the euro area, the seasonally-adjusted production of the construction sector in August decreased by 0.2 percent month on month and rose by 1.6 percent year on year. In July, production had remained stable compared to June, according to the newly revised data.

Building construction in the EU-28 in August decreased by 0.6 percent month on month and was up three percent year on year, while civil engineering output in the region increased by 0.4 percent from July and was up by 3.6 percent year on year. In the euro area, building construction decreased by 0.2 percent month on month and was up 1.7 percent year on year, while civil engineering output in the region decreased by 0.1 percent month on month and rose by 0.6 percent year on year.

As compared to August last year, construction output in August this year increased by 36.8 percent in Hungary, by 23.2 percent in Poland and by 14.7 percent in Sweden, while a decrease of 1.1 percent was registered in Italy, a drop of 0.6 percent was seen in Romania, with 0.4 percent declines registered in Belgium and Spain.

As compared to July, construction output in August this year decreased by 9.7 percent in Sweden, by 3.6 percent in Slovenia, by 1.4 percent in Slovakia and by 1.2 percent in Germany, while construction output increased by 9.8 percent in Hungary, by 1.8 percent in Italy and by 0.9 percent in Bulgaria.
